Output d8a68894203fbb6dabed73f6727f0691a17518472da501e00c3385f6c0dfa8a2:14

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 5a2007f3a02241b4059c7a8410f3bfb75be71742
address
bc1qtgsq0uaqyfqmgpvu02zppualkad7w96za5mf2c
transaction
d8a68894203fbb6dabed73f6727f0691a17518472da501e00c3385f6c0dfa8a2
confirmations
33902
spent
true